Transaction fb20863954dab3fbbb7423d5a6afad2c68c22b5289f2283906892da833517c04
1 Input
1 Output
-
fb20863954dab3fbbb7423d5a6afad2c68c22b5289f2283906892da833517c04:0
- value
- 298536
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 15bba4173e9b2c0031dda8a4445d5107d05e57c69039eba6f7e36403fc46f9e9
- address
- bc1pzka6g9e7nvkqqvwa4zjygh23qlg9u47xjqu7hfhhudjq8lzxl85s6ffzrd